What are the specs of the Alcatel Pixi 4 (3.5)?

The Alcatel Pixi 4 (3.5) is a 3.5-inch device with a resolution of 320 x 480 pixels. It is powered by a 1.3GHz dual-core processor and has 512MB of RAM. It has 4GB of internal storage, which can be expanded up to 32GB via a microSD card. It has a 2-megapixel rear camera and a 0.3-megapixel front-facing camera.

What is the battery capacity of the Alcatel Pixi 4 (3.5)?

The Alcatel Pixi 4 (3.5) has a removable Li-Ion 1300 mAh battery.

What version of Android does the Alcatel Pixi 4 (3.5) run?

The Alcatel Pixi 4 (3.5) runs Android 5.1 Lollipop.


Specifications

Network

Technology: GSM / HSPA
2G bands: GSM 850 / 900 / 1800 / 1900
3G bands: HSDPA 900 / 2100
: HSDPA 850 / 900 / 2100
Speed: HSPA 21.1/5.76 Mbps

Launch

Announced: 2016, January. Released 2016, Q3
Status: Discontinued

Body

Dimensions: 116 x 62 x 10 mm (4.57 x 2.44 x 0.39 in)
Weight: -
SIM: Micro-SIM

Display

Type: TFT
Size: 3.5 inches, 36.5 cm2 (~50.7% screen-to-body ratio)
Resolution: 320 x 480 pixels, 3:2 ratio (~165 ppi density)

Platform

OS: Android 5.1 (Lollipop)
Chipset: Mediatek MT6572M (28 nm)
CPU: Dual-core 1.0 GHz Cortex-A7
GPU: Mali-400

Memory

Card slot: microSDHC (dedicated slot)
Internal: 4GB 512MB RAM

Main Camera

Single: 2 MP
Features: LED flash
Video: 480p@15fps

Selfie camera

Single: VGA
Video:

Sound

Loudspeaker: Yes
3.5mm jack: Yes

Comms

WLAN: Wi-Fi 802.11 b/g/n, Wi-Fi Direct, hotspot
Bluetooth: 4.0, A2DP
Positioning: GPS (optional)
NFC: No
Radio: FM radio
USB: microUSB 2.0

Features

Sensors: Accelerometer

Battery

Type: Li-Ion 1300 mAh, removable
Stand-by: Up to 250 h (2G) / Up to 250 h (3G)
Talk time: Up to 4 h (3G)

Misc

Colors: Black, White
